AmarnathYatra: Div Com, ADGP review arrangements

JAMMU, JUNE 13: Emphasising upon the stakeholder departments to synergize efforts to make adequate arrangements well in advance for smooth conduct of the holy Yatra, the Divisional Commissioner Jammu, Ramesh Kumar directed for expediting sanitation work, face lifting and other works required at YatriNiwas.
Divisional Commissioner Jammu, Ramesh Kumar alongwith Additional Director General of Police Jammu Zone, Mukesh Singh on Tuesday chaired a meeting to review the arrangements for the ShriAmarnathJiYatra- 2023.
The Divisional Commissioner directed Deputy Commissioners to identify locations for accommodation, holding spaces in their respective districts.
The DCs were further directed to identify suitable places for langers and accommodation of devotees, vehicles holding in their respective districts.
Threadbare discussions were held on the important issues, while the Divisional Commissioner reviewed registration arrangements including RFID, security arrangements, transportation facilities for sadhus and yatries, setting up of langars and their permissions, accommodation for sadhus and Yatris, sanitation, boarding and lodging facilities at yatriniwas, besides public address system.
The Div Com also reviewed in detail parking arrangements at Bhagwati Nagar, security arrangements and installation of CCTVs, medical facilities, provisions of water, power supply etc.
The Div Com instructed the Traffic Department to formulate a traffic plan for smooth flow of traffic on important routes.
The Div Com also directed JMC for cleanliness and beautification of city and other related works, while PWD was directed to ensure blacktopping of the approach roads well in advance to ensure traffic worthiness of the same.
While reviewing transportation facilities, the Divisional Commissionerasked MD JKRTC to make provisions of additional buses at YatriNiwas and en-route the districts.
The Divisional Commissionerinstructed the DCs to ensure functioning of toilet complexes  and install an adequate number of mobile toilets and water coolers en-route the highway for the convenience of the pilgrims.
He asked DCs of Ramban, Samba, Udhampur, Kathua and Jammu to conduct visits to identified lodgement centres and ensure the availability of water, power and toilets at each centre.
The Div Com also reviewed in detail about the facilities at YatriNiwasBhagwati Nagar and issued directions for putting in all necessary arrangements in time.
The Divisional Commissionerdirected NHAI to ensure cleanliness of National Highway in view of construction work executed. He directed to remove unwanted construction materials from the road.
The Divisional Commissioner instructed all the concerned departments to expedite the works to ensure that all necessary arrangements are put in place well before commencement of the Yatra.
ADGP issued directions for proper security arrangements, Traffic arrangements, Proper handing taking over, CCTV installation on Langer and lodging centres. He also directed concerned officers to ensure Cut off time is follow properly.
ADGP also stressed on setting up of joint control rooms at Jammu and Ramban comprising of officers from Army, CRPF and police. He emphasized on close coordination among all the security agencies to ensure smooth conduct of Yatra.
The meeting was attended by IG CRPF, Mahesh Laddha; Inspector General (IG) of Border Security Force (BSF), D K Boora; IG Traffic, Bhim Singh Tuti; DIG Traffic, Shridhar Patel; DIGs of Jammu Samba Kathua Range, ReasiUdhampur range, RambanKishtwar range, Commissioner JMC, Deputy Commissioners of Udhampur, Kathua, Samba and Ramban, Joint Director Information, ADC Jammu, besides senior officers of Army, JPDCL, Jal Shakti, PWD, Tourism, Health, NHAI, and other concerned departments while outstation officers participated through video conferencing.
